Tracking an early week warm-up and mid-week showers

Tonight: Partly cloudy skies and southerly flowing winds tonight help keep us just above freezing tonight with an overnight low of 33 degrees.

Tomorrow: Winds continue out of the southwest at 5-10 mph with partly cloudy skies. Highs climb back into the lower '60s.

Extended: Tuesday temperatures continue to rise to the lower '70s by Tuesday afternoon. Wednesday morning showers pull back into Central Missouri with a passing cold front. Skies clear heading into the weekend with highs cooling down once again.
